Impact

By implementing funding for generators, HB 05071 aims to enhance the safety and welfare of residents in state-funded group homes. The provision of generators will enable these facilities to maintain essential services during outages, ensuring that residents receive continuous care and support. Such an investment underscores a commitment to the health and safety of vulnerable populations, particularly those who rely on medical equipment that requires electricity.

Summary

House Bill 05071, titled 'An Act Concerning Generators In State-funded Group Homes,' addresses the critical need for reliable power sources in group homes that receive state funding. The bill mandates the provision of funding within the current biennial budget specifically for the purpose of acquiring generators. This legislative action highlights the importance of ensuring that individuals in state-funded facilities are protected during power outages and emergencies.
